Published by Taschen, Le Corbusier by Jean-Louis Cohen. Even in his unrealised projects, Le Corbusier redefined modern living, synthesising functionalism, expressionism, and expansive urban thinking from Switzerland to Chandigarh, India. This book provides a succinct introduction to his trailblazing ideas, writings, and buildings, which continue to resonate and influence to this day.
